    The Modern Era of Cycling Rivalries: Tadej Pogačar and Mathieu van der Poel

     

    The landscape of cycling has witnessed many legendary rivalries over the years, from the epic duels between Eddy Merckx and Raymond Poulidor to the intense battles between Miguel Indurain and Claudio Chiappucci. However, since the turn of the century, particularly in the 2020s, the rivalry between Tadej Pogačar and Mathieu van der Poel has emerged as one of the most captivating stories in the sport. Their contrasting styles, backgrounds, and personalities combine to create a narrative that resonates not just with cycling fans but with the broader sports community. Yet, as with any great rivalry, there are complexities and downsides, highlighted by reflections from former champions, notably concerning the potential overshadowing of other talents.

     

     

    The Rise of Tadej Pogačar and Mathieu van der Poel

     

    Tadej Pogačar, the Slovenian cycling prodigy from UAE Team Emirates, burst onto the scene by winning the 2020 Tour de France at the tender age of 21. His blend of climbing ability, time-trialing skill, and race intelligence quickly made him a dominant force in grand tours. Pogačar’s approach to racing is characterized by a strategic mindset; he is not just strong but also intelligent about when and how to attack.

    On the other hand, Mathieu van der Poel, the Dutch cyclo-cross champion and multi-discipline cyclist, represents a different facet of cycling brilliance. With a background in mountain biking and cyclo-cross, van der Poel’s arrival on the road racing scene has been marked by explosive speed and versatility. He has a penchant for attacking early in races and has been known to thrive in one-day classics, showcasing his ability across varied terrains.

     

    Their rivalry reached new heights as both riders competed at the highest level in various races, particularly in the 2021 and 2022 seasons. Whether it was during the Tour de France, World Championships, or iconic classics like the Ronde van Vlaanderen, every encounter between Pogačar and van der Poel seemed to produce thrilling moments.

     

     

    The Intriguing Dynamics of Their Rivalry

     

    Fans and analysts alike have been drawn to the stylistic contrasts between the two athletes. While Pogačar often employs a calculated approach, preferring to conserve energy until the right moment to strike, van der Poel embodies a more aggressive racing style, frequently taking audacious risks to gain an advantage. This juxtaposition creates a compelling spectacle for those watching, as each race featuring the two is as much about tactics as it is about raw power.

     

    Furthermore, their personalities are markedly different. Pogačar is often perceived as the humble and reserved athlete, a quiet achiever who lets his results speak for themselves. Van der Poel, contrastingly, is seen as charismatic, often displaying passion and flair in both his racing style and public demeanor. This contrast plays a significant role in attracting diverse fan bases.

     

     

    The Critique of Dominance

     

    Despite the excitement that Pogačar and van der Poel bring to the sport, former Tour de France winner and cycling legend, Cadel Evans, has voiced concerns regarding the implications of their dominance. Evans argues that while having standout riders can generate media attention and commercial viability for cycling, it also comes with certain drawbacks.

     

    **1. Marketability Over Diversity:**

     

    The overwhelming focus on Pogačar and van der Poel can overshadow other talented cyclists. As marketers and sponsors gravitate towards riders who consistently podium, lesser-known but equally skilled athletes risk being neglected. This creates a cycling dynamic where the sport’s marketability may prioritize a select few, diminishing the overall diversity of talent showcased in major international events.

     

    **2. Pressure on Emerging Talents:**

     

    The presence of two dominant figures can create an almost insurmountable benchmark for emerging cyclists. Young riders who aspire to reach the elite level may find themselves under immense pressure to compete with the extraordinary performances set by Pogačar and van der Poel. As a result, the path to recognition for these young talents can become disheartening, leading to potential burnout or disillusionment.

     

    **3. Stifling Potential Competition:**

     

    Cadel Evans has also expressed concerns about how the focus on this rivalry might stifle potential emerging rivalries. If fans begin to view only Pogačar and van der Poel as true contenders for victory, it may dissuade other cyclists from believing they can compete at the same level. In a sport that thrives on competition, this could lead to an environment where many promising riders never reach their full potential merely because they do not have the backing or recognition that the top two enjoy.

     

     

    The Larger Impact of Rivalries

     

    Despite these critiques, it is essential to consider that rivalries such as Pogačar vs. van der Poel have historically been pivotal for enhancing the overall spectacle of the sport. They create narratives that can elevate the profile of cycling. Television ratings spike during events featuring intense rivalries, and this increased visibility often leads to greater sponsorship deals, consequently benefiting the sport at large.

     

    Moreover, a strong, competitive rivalry can inspire a new generation of cyclists. Young people who witness these epic showdowns may find their passion for cycling reignited. Just as fans of history’s greatest rivalries—whether in cycling, football, or other sports—draw inspiration and excitement from the competition, Pogačar and van der Poel’s rivalry can motivate younger athletes to chase their dreams.

     

     

    The Future of Cycling’s Star Dynamic

     

    As the current cycling season progresses, the question of how to achieve a balance between celebrating Pogačar and van der Poel while also promoting diverse talents looms large. Engaging with events that spotlight other competitive cyclists, cultivating the narrative of emerging stars, and encouraging fair competition across the board will be essential for the health of the sport.

     

    The potential for a new generation of cyclists to come forth exists, but it requires the cycling community to embrace these athletes rather than allowing the overwhelming focus on a select few to persist. Cycling is rich with stories waiting to be told, and the competition should be broad enough to allow every capable athlete the chance to shine.

     

     

    The rivalry between Tadej Pogačar and Mathieu van der Poel marks a significant chapter in the history of cycling, captivating fans with a blend of skill, strategy, and individual flair. While their battles promise to continue enthralling audiences globally, it is crucial for the cycling community to address the issues stemming from their dominance. By fostering an environment that celebrates a range of talents while cherishing the excitement brought forth by this rivalry, cycling can not only thrive but also ensure its rich heritage endures for future generations. In this dance of wheels and determination, there is room for more than just two stars to shine.
